chaoschao said:Did you even play Kingdom Hearts to the end? If you did, you'd remember that her grandmother gave a speech on light and the door (kingdom hearts itself).
Here's the exact quote:
Kairi's Grandmother: (to young Kairi) Long ago, people lived in peace,
bathed in the warmth of light. Everyone loved the light. Then people
began to fight over it. They wanted to keep it for themselves. And
darkness was born in their hearts. The darkness spread, swallowing the
light and many people's hearts. It covered everything, and the world
disappeared. But small fragments of light survived...in the hearts of
children. With these fragments of light, children rebuilt the lost
world. It's the world we live in now. But the true light sleeps, deep
within the darkness. That's why the worlds are still scattered, divided
from each other. But someday, a door to the innermost darkness will
open. And the true light will return. So, listen, child. Even in the
deepest darkness, there will always be a light to guide you. Believe in
the light, and the darkness will never defeat you. Your heart will
shine with its power and push the darkness away. Do you understand,
Kairi?
